Two ways to read the storm

How Alzada saw the hail — from two instruments

Two instruments, one storm: NEXRAD logs the point signatures it detected overhead, while the estimated-size surface models how large the hail aloft could have grown. Agreement between them is not guaranteed — the gaps are where the model ran ahead of, or behind, the detections.

The storm in context

Where Apr 13, 2026 sits in Alzada's hail record

This was Alzada's 1st recorded hail day — the first hail day in our records for the city. By severity it ranks 4th of the 7 storms we have logged here. Radar put the day's largest stone over Alzada at 1.75" — the largest NEXRAD radar signature.

The Apr 13, 2026 convective day was bigger than Alzada: the same system put hail over 467 other tracked cities, 1 of them in Montana. Nearest: Weston (32 miles southwest, up to 1.5"); Buffalo (40 miles northeast, up to 2"); Camp Crook (45 miles northeast, up to 2").

A storm day here is a convective day — it runs from noon to noon UTC, so late-night hail is grouped with the afternoon storm that spawned it rather than split across two calendar dates.
